Today was our first day back after a 1 1/2 week break. It seemed to me in December that LHFHG wasn't quite reaching my ds6/1st grade where he is at. So I moved him up to Beyond today. He absolutely Loved it! It is the most interest I have ever seen him show in school. My 8 & 4 year old joined in quite a bit with him too. We had a Great discussion about responsibility and responsibility around the house and responsibility to the family. Wonderful!!

Thank you Carrie! My DH and I prayed about it and we decided to go ahead and order Bigger for my oldest. It just looks the perfect fit for him, and uses the English 2 and Singapore 2A that he has been doing since September. I think it will make as big a difference for him (8/2nd grade) as Beyond is making for my ds6/1st grade. The Bible today in Beyond was absolutely wonderful. We had some more good discussion both as a Bible study and on character issues that really matter to my heart. Wonderful!

It makes all the difference to find the right fit.
